Maintenance

A coffee machine for pods offers many advantages over a traditional coffee maker. A pod coffee maker, for example, can reduce waste while the brewing process is easy and efficient. However the pod coffee machine requires regular cleaning and descaling in order to get the best outcomes. In addition, the device requires a water reservoir and drip tray to work correctly. Clean the drip tray and reservoir with clean water each time you use your coffee machine. This will keep the coffee machine clean and prevent a buildup of grime.

A clean pod machine is more hygienic. Empty the capsules and clean the receptacle. You should also wash the inside of the machine regularly. Descale the machine to eliminate mineral deposits. Ideally, you should do this every three months.

Some pod coffee machines are equipped with an automatic descaling mechanism that is helpful to remove deposits. The system might not work in the way it should, and could leave residues behind in the machine. Pour white vinegar distilled into the reservoir for water of the coffee maker which does not have an descaling solution. This will get rid of the limescale buildup and other deposits that are present in the coffee maker.
